In this manner, is Martin better than Taylor?

Taylors are generally known for having a very bright yet rich sound, with more clarity but perhaps less body than a Martin. The company is also praised for guitar-to-guitar consistency and build quality.

Is Martin or Gibson better?

Gibson acoustic guitars often sound fuller than Martin’s which usually sound more delicate. Martin offers guitars for all price ranges whilst Gibson only make high end guitars. Gibson mainly make dreadnought and jumbo guitars whereas Martin mainly make dreadnoughts, mid-sized and smaller shapes.

What is the origin of guitar in the Philippines?

Guitars, or “gitaras” as their known locally, were first introduced to the island during the Spanish Era, with their name derived from the Spanish word “kitara”. Spanish friars brought their “kitaras” with them to the Philippines. As time passed by, their stringed instruments wore out.

Why are Martin guitars so hard to play?

Old Martin Guitars

Back in old days, acoustic guitars didn’t have an adjustable truss rod, which now helps them keep necks from warping constantly. Instead, they used different reinforcement methods, which made the guitars feel bulkier, heavier, and even more difficult to play.

Why do Cebuanos make guitars?

Guitars especially made from Cebu are famous throughout the Philippines because of their affordable price, world-class quality and durability. Cebu has a long history of guitar making due to its traditional industry. Most of the guitar manufacturers are family-owned enterprises passed on from one generation to another.
